EXHORDER Schedules Another Louisiana Date - Nov. 20, 2009
Reactivated legendary New Orleans metallers EXHORDER — cited by many as the originators of the riff-heavy power-groove approach popularized by PANTERA (photo) — will perform at The City Club in Houma, Louisiana on December 12. Support at the show will come from BLACKWATER BURIAL.

EXHORDER returned to the live arena this past Saturday, November 14 at Southport Hall in Jefferson, Louisiana. This marked the band's first live performance since EXHORDER's March 2001 reunion shows at Zeppelin's in Metairie, Louisiana.

The group's encore consisted of a medley of S.O.D.'s "March of the S.O.D.", "Sargent D and the S.O.D." and "United Forces", a cover of the punk rock classic "Somebody's Gonna Get Their Head Kicked In Tonight" (by THE REZILLOS) and "Ripping Flesh" from EXHORDER's 1986 "Get Rude" demo — a song they hadn't played since 1989.

EXHORDER's lineup for the Southport Hall date was as follows:

Kyle Thomas - Vocals
Vinnie Labella - Guitar
Jay Ceravolo - Guitar
Chris Nail - Drums
Frankie Sparcello - Bass

Poland's Metal Mind Productions re-released the two albums (1990's "Slaughter in the Vatican" and 1992's "The Law") from EXHORDER in May 2008. Each limited-edition digipack title (limited to 2,000 copies) was made available on golden disc, digitally remastered using 24-bit technology.
